Abstract
Preliminary tests were conducted to evaluate the potential for using KrF excimer lasers for removing unwanted material from fragile, damaged, or otherwise problematic paint surfaces where conventional cleaning methods might not be satisfactory. Some examples: removal of adhesive tape from unbound pigment; removal of surface coatings from underbound matte paint of similar solubility parameter; removal of spray paint from unvarnioshed acrylic, marker, and pastel; removal of soot and other stains from a fresh acrylic film; and removal of surface coatings from poorly adhered, flaking substrates. Results of the tests are evaluated and described, including details of the laser irradiation parameters, visual observation, microscopic observation, and reflectance spectrophotometry. Preliminary conclusions are proposed.
